真实的国产乱ⅩXXX66竹夫人,五月香六月婷婷激情综合,亚洲日本VA一区二区三区,亚洲精品一区二区三区麻豆

成都創(chuàng)新互聯(lián)網(wǎng)站制作重慶分公司

oracle腳本怎么設(shè)置 oracle腳本編寫(xiě)

win10系統(tǒng)下怎樣用oracle生成新建數(shù)據(jù)庫(kù)腳本

1/s/1gfa3e63;這里是我在Oracle官網(wǎng)下載好了Windows系統(tǒng)64位的安裝包,有2個(gè)zip文件。不想去官網(wǎng)找下載地址的童鞋可以直接用這個(gè)百度云盤(pán)的下載鏈接。1.去下載最新的oracle11g安裝包的壓縮文件,有2個(gè)壓縮文件,都需要下載,下載完成以后需要解壓縮在同一個(gè)目錄下。在開(kāi)始o(jì)racle數(shù)據(jù)安裝之前建議:1.關(guān)閉本機(jī)的病毒防火墻。2.斷開(kāi)互聯(lián)網(wǎng)。這樣可以避免解壓縮丟失文件和安裝失敗。2.我在下載好2個(gè)zip文件后,都解壓在了database目錄中。如下圖:3.進(jìn)入database雙擊 setup.exe 開(kāi)始安裝,在如下圖:4.出現(xiàn)如下選項(xiàng),選擇是,繼續(xù)安裝。當(dāng)然這是我機(jī)器出現(xiàn)了這個(gè)情況,可能你的滿足要求了。。。5.取消勾,點(diǎn)擊下一步:6.Oracle在進(jìn)行安裝的時(shí)候都會(huì)詢問(wèn)是否同時(shí)創(chuàng)建一個(gè)數(shù)據(jù)庫(kù)出來(lái),此處選擇“創(chuàng)建和配置數(shù)據(jù)庫(kù)”。7.每一個(gè)數(shù)據(jù)庫(kù)可以想象為一個(gè)實(shí)例,所以此處表示只存在一個(gè)數(shù)據(jù)庫(kù)的含義8.此處選擇“高級(jí)安裝”。9.語(yǔ)言現(xiàn)在選擇支持“簡(jiǎn)體中文”和“英文”。10.選擇“企業(yè)版”。11.此處設(shè)置Oracle的安裝目錄,將其安裝到app目錄下。12.選擇一般事物 13.此處輸入數(shù)據(jù)庫(kù)的名稱,同時(shí)SID與數(shù)據(jù)庫(kù)的名稱相同。14.使用默認(rèn)配置,如下圖:15.Oracle本身提供了多個(gè)操作用戶,為了簡(jiǎn)單管理,所有的密碼都統(tǒng)一設(shè)置為“oracleadmin”。隨后將進(jìn)行安裝環(huán)境的檢驗(yàn),如果檢驗(yàn)之中出現(xiàn)了錯(cuò)誤,則會(huì)提示用戶,或者由用戶選擇“忽略”。16.選擇完成開(kāi)始安裝17.而后進(jìn)入到了oracle的安裝界面。此界面會(huì)運(yùn)行一段時(shí)間,在此界面完成之后出現(xiàn)的任何界面都不要點(diǎn)任何的確定按鈕,因?yàn)檫€需要進(jìn)行后續(xù)的配置。18.安裝完成之后會(huì)進(jìn)入到配置用戶口令界面,點(diǎn)擊 用戶口令 設(shè)置密碼。此界面之中需要進(jìn)行用戶名及密碼的配置,在使用Oracle數(shù)據(jù)庫(kù)過(guò)程之中,主要使用三個(gè)用戶(有三個(gè)用戶的密碼是public password,在實(shí)際中不可以使用):超級(jí)管理員:sys / change_on_install;普通管理員:system / manager;普通用戶:scott / tiger,此用戶需要配置解鎖;19.完成之后選擇“確定”那么再之后就可以進(jìn)入到安裝完成的界面,選擇“關(guān)閉”即可。20.在Oracle安裝完成之后,可以通過(guò)windows的服務(wù)找到所有與Oracle有關(guān)的服務(wù)選項(xiàng)。21.所有的服務(wù)建議將其全部修改為手工啟動(dòng),這樣電腦的啟動(dòng)速度可以快一些。但是有兩個(gè)服務(wù)是必須啟動(dòng)的:OracleOraDb11g_home1TNSListener:數(shù)據(jù)庫(kù)的監(jiān)聽(tīng)服務(wù),當(dāng)使用任何的編程語(yǔ)言或者是前臺(tái)工具連接數(shù)據(jù)庫(kù)的時(shí)候,此服務(wù)必須啟動(dòng),否則無(wú)法連接;OracleServiceSYNC:指的是數(shù)據(jù)庫(kù)的實(shí)例服務(wù),實(shí)例服務(wù)的命名規(guī)范“OracleServiceSID”,一般SID的名稱都和數(shù)據(jù)庫(kù)的名稱保持一致,每一個(gè)數(shù)據(jù)庫(kù)的服務(wù)都會(huì)創(chuàng)建一個(gè)sid。這里我的數(shù)據(jù)庫(kù)的SID是sync。2. 使用sqlplus命令設(shè)置數(shù)據(jù)庫(kù)1.當(dāng)oracle安裝完成之后,下面就需要對(duì)其進(jìn)行使用,Oracle本身提供了一個(gè)“sqlplus.exe”的操作命令,直接運(yùn)行此命令即可。2.此處輸入用戶名為scott,密碼為tiger。 3.在數(shù)據(jù)庫(kù)之中會(huì)存在多張數(shù)據(jù)表,那么下面發(fā)出一個(gè)查詢emp表的操作命令,輸入命令如下,默認(rèn)的顯示方式并不是特別的好,此處可以使用以下的命令更改顯示方式 4.在Oracle之中會(huì)存在多種用戶,如果要想切換不同的用戶,可以使用如下的命令完成,如果現(xiàn)在使用的是sys用戶登錄,那么就必須加上“AS SYSDBA”表示由管理員登錄,其他用戶不需要。CONN 用戶名/密碼 [AS SYSDBA] ;范例:使用sys登錄conn sys/change_on_install AS sysdba 如果要想查看當(dāng)前用戶輸入“show user”命令即可查看。show user 5.如果說(shuō)現(xiàn)在使用sys用戶登錄,并且發(fā)出同樣的查詢命令,會(huì)發(fā)現(xiàn)找不到emp表的錯(cuò)誤提示:6.因?yàn)檫@張表屬于scott用戶,所以當(dāng)使用scott用戶登錄的時(shí)候可以直接使用此表,但是如果換了一個(gè)用戶,那么就必須使用這個(gè)表的完整名稱“用戶名.表名稱”,emp屬于scott的,所以全名是“scott.emp”。以上所述是小編給大家?guī)?lái)的Oracle11g數(shù)據(jù)庫(kù)win8.1系統(tǒng)安裝配置圖文教程,希望對(duì)大家有所幫助,如果大家有任何疑問(wèn)歡迎給我留言,小編會(huì)及時(shí)回復(fù)大家的!

永登ssl適用于網(wǎng)站、小程序/APP、API接口等需要進(jìn)行數(shù)據(jù)傳輸應(yīng)用場(chǎng)景,ssl證書(shū)未來(lái)市場(chǎng)廣闊!成為創(chuàng)新互聯(lián)的ssl證書(shū)銷售渠道,可以享受市場(chǎng)價(jià)格4-6折優(yōu)惠!如果有意向歡迎電話聯(lián)系或者加微信:028-86922220(備注:SSL證書(shū)合作)期待與您的合作!

Oracle數(shù)據(jù)庫(kù)RMAN的自動(dòng)備份腳本簡(jiǎn)介

Oracle數(shù)據(jù)庫(kù)RMAN的自動(dòng)備份腳本簡(jiǎn)介

各位同學(xué)知道Oracle數(shù)據(jù)庫(kù)RMAN如何自動(dòng)備份腳本嘛?下面我為大家整理了關(guān)于Oracle數(shù)據(jù)庫(kù)RMAN的自動(dòng)備份腳本文章,希望能為你提供幫助:

1、數(shù)據(jù)庫(kù)設(shè)置為歸檔方式

2、數(shù)據(jù)庫(kù)的備份腳本

db_full_backup.sh :數(shù)據(jù)庫(kù)全備腳本

db_l0_backup.sh :數(shù)據(jù)庫(kù)0級(jí)備份腳本

db_l1_backup.sh :數(shù)據(jù)庫(kù)1級(jí)備份腳本

:數(shù)據(jù)FTP上傳腳本

ftp_del.sh :數(shù)據(jù)FTP清理腳本

rman_bak.sh :數(shù)據(jù)備份主程序

3、備份原理

每周1、3、6進(jìn)行0級(jí)備份

每周日、2、4、5進(jìn)行1級(jí)備份

備份文件上傳到FTP服務(wù)器

FTP服務(wù)器每周清理一次,但是清理后將周六和周日的備份進(jìn)行保留(6.bak和0.bak)

所有工作防暑crontab中自動(dòng)執(zhí)行備份

4、備份目錄含義

arc :數(shù)據(jù)庫(kù)歸檔目錄

rmanbak :數(shù)據(jù)庫(kù)備份文件的保存目錄

rmanscripts :數(shù)據(jù)庫(kù)腳本存放路徑

5、FTP目錄

ftp上必須手動(dòng)建立目錄

L0:

---1

---3

---6

---6.bak

L1:

---2

---4

---5

---0

---0.bak

rman_bak.sh腳本主程序

#!/bin/bash

#--------------------------------------------

# Oracle auto backup using rman

#

# author:songrh

# week:1,3,6 Level 0 backup

# 2,4,5,0 Level 1 backup

# Copyright by ChenLong Tec

#--------------------------------------------

#

#

export ORACLE_BASE=/u02/oracle

export ORACLE_HOME=/u02/oracle/product/9.2.4

export ORACLE_SID=PROD

export LD_LIBRARY_PATH=$ORACLE_HOME/lib

export CLASSPATH=$ORACLE_HOME/JRE:$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ib:$ORACLE_HOME/network/jlib

export NLS_LANG=american_america.ZHS16GBK

export TNS_ADMIN=$ORACLE_HOME/network/admin

export ORA_NL33=$ORACLE_HOME/ocommon/nls/admin/data

export PATH=/bin:/usr/bin:/usr/sbin:$ORACLE_HOME/bin:$PATH

export PATH=$PATH:/opt/local/bin

#

SH_PATH=/u02/rmanscripts

ARC_PATH=/u02/arch

RMAN_BAK_PATH=/u02/rmanbak

#

#FULL_PATH=$RMAN_BAK_PATH/full

L0_PATH=$RMAN_BAK_PATH/L0

L1_PATH=$RMAN_BAK_PATH/L1

#

#DAY_TAG=`date "%Y-%m-%d"`

LOG_TAG=`date "%Y-%m-%d"`

#FIRST_DAY=`date %e`

WEEK=`date %w`

#WEEK=1

#

# FTP configure

IP="122.120.150.155"

FTPUSER="ftpbak"

FTPPASS="******"

FTPROOT0="L0"

FTPROOT1="L1"

#

DISK_USE=`df -k |sed -n '/u02/'p | awk '{print $5}' |sed 's/%//'`

####check path function

############

if [[ $DISK_USE -ge 90 ]]; then

rm -rf $L0_PATH/*

rm -rf $L1_PATH/*

fi

if [ "$WEEK" = "6" -o "$WEEK" = "3" -o "$WEEK" = "1" ]; then

if [ ! -d $L0_PATH ]; then

mkdir $L0_PATH

fi

if [ "$WEEK" = "1" ]; then

rm -rf $L0_PATH/*

rm -rf $L1_PATH/*

mkdir $L0_PATH/$WEEK

$SH_PATH/db_l0_backup.sh $L0_PATH/$WEEK

cd $L0_PATH/$WEEK

$SH_PATH/ftp_del.sh $IP $FTPUSER $FTPPASS $FTPROOT0 $WEEK $WEEK_$LOG_TAG.log

else

if [ ! -d $L0_PATH/$WEEK ]; then

mkdir $L0_PATH/$WEEK

$SH_PATH/db_l0_backup.sh $L0_PATH/$WEEK

cd $L0_PATH/$WEEK

$SH_PATH/ $IP $FTPUSER $FTPPASS $FTPROOT0 $WEEK $WEEK_$LOG_TAG.log

else

;

linux下怎么配置oracle開(kāi)機(jī)自動(dòng)啟動(dòng)腳本

說(shuō)明:以下操作環(huán)境在CentOS 6.4 + Oracle 11gR2(Oracle安裝在ORACLE_BASE=/opt/oracle中,其ORACLE_HOME=/opt/oracle/11g)

用OUI安裝并配置Oracle數(shù)據(jù)庫(kù)后,Oracle就開(kāi)啟了(包括:數(shù)據(jù)庫(kù)實(shí)例、監(jiān)聽(tīng)器、EM)。在重啟操作系統(tǒng)之后,Oracle默認(rèn)是沒(méi)有啟動(dòng)的。使用如下命令查看Oracle相關(guān)服務(wù)是否已啟動(dòng):

ps aux | grep ora_ #若無(wú)ora_**_**相關(guān)的進(jìn)程,則oracle數(shù)據(jù)庫(kù)實(shí)例未啟動(dòng)

netstat -tlnup | grep 1521 #若無(wú)任何顯示,則監(jiān)聽(tīng)器未啟動(dòng)

lsnrctl status #查看監(jiān)聽(tīng)器狀態(tài)

netstat -tlnup | grep 1158 #若無(wú)任何顯示,則EM未啟動(dòng)

emctl status dbconsole #查看EM狀態(tài)

oracle設(shè)置環(huán)境變量腳本

#!/bin/bash

#centos oracle g 前期安裝環(huán)境檢查腳本

#將所需要安裝的包(rpm格式)與腳本放在一個(gè)目錄下

ss=$PWD

cd $ss

rpm ivh * rpm

#ORACLE_BASE=/opt/oracle

echo n 輸入ORACLE_BASE(默認(rèn)/opt/oracle):

read ORACLE_BASE

if [ z $ORACLE_BASE ]

then

ORACLE_BASE=/opt/oracle

fi

#ORACLE_HOME=$ORACLE_BASE/product/ /db_

echo n 輸入 HOME (默認(rèn) product/ /db_ ):

read HOME

if [ z $HOME ]

then

HOME=product/ /db_

fi

ORACLE_HOME=$ORACLE_BASE/$HOME

#ORACLE_SID=oral

echo n 輸入 ORACLE_SID (默認(rèn) orcl):

read ORACLE_SID

if [ z $ORACLE_SID ]

then

ORACLE_SID=orcl

fi

USER=oracle

SYSCTL=/etc/nf

LIMITS=/etc/security/nf

PAM=/etc/pam d/login

PROFILE=/etc/profile

BASH_PROFILE=/home/oracle/ bash_profile

#IPADDR=`ifconfig eth |grep inet addr |cut d : f | cut d f `

#HOSTS=/etc/hosts

#NEORK=/etc/sysconfig/neork

#hostname

#grep v HOSTNAME $NEORK $NEORK

#echo HOSTNAME=$HOSTNAME $NEORK

#echo $IPADDR $HOSTNAME $HOSTS

#加入用戶

useradd g oinstall G dba? $USER

groupadd oinstall

groupadd dba

mkdir p $ORACLE_BASE

chown R $USER:oinstall $ORACLE_BASE

#內(nèi)核設(shè)置

cat $SYSCTL EOF

kernel msgmni=

kernel shmmni=

kernel sem=

fs file max=

net ipv ip_local_port_range=

net ipv tcp_sack=

net ipv tcp_timestamps=

net ipv tcp_max_syn_backlog=

net ipv tcp_keepalive_time=

re rmem_default=

re rmem_max=

re wmem_default=

re wmem_max=

EOF

#限制設(shè)置

cat $LIMITS EOF

oracle????????????? soft??? nproc??

oracle????????????? hard??? nproc??

oracle????????????? soft??? nofile?

oracle????????????? hard??? nofile?

EOF

#安全設(shè)置

cat $PAM EOF

session??? required???? /lib/security/pam_limits so

session??? required???? pam_limits so

EOF

#全局環(huán)境變量設(shè)置

cat $PROFILE EOF

if [ \$USER = oracle ]; then

if [ \$SHELL = /bin/ksh ]; then

ulimit p

ulimit n

else

ulimit u n

fi

fi

EOF

#oracle環(huán)境變量設(shè)置

cat $BASH_PROFILE EOF

export LC_CTYPE=en_US UTF

export ORACLE_SID=orcl

export ORACLE_BASE=/opt/oracle

export ORACLE_HOME=/opt/oracle/product/ /db_

export TNS_ADMIN=$ORACLE_HOME/neork/admin

export ORA_DB=$ORACLE_HOME/dbs

export ORACLE_BDUMP=$ORACLE_BASE/shtkt/bdump

export ORACLE_TERM=xterm

export NLS_LANG=AMERICAN_AMERICA ZHS GBK

export ORA_NLS =$ORACLE_HOME/omon/nls/admin/data

export LD_LIBRARY_PATH=$ORACLE_HOME/lib:/lib:/usr/lib:/usr/local/lib

export LIBPATH=$ORACLE_HOME/lib:$ORACLE_HOME/ctx/lib

export CLASSPATH=$ORACLE_HOME/JRE/lib:$ORACLE_HOME/JRE/lib/rt jar:$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ib

PATH=$PATH:$HOME/bin:$ORACLE_HOME/bin

export PATH

umask

EOF

source /home/oracle/ bash_profile

sleep

export DISPLAY=:

xhost +

export LC_ALL=en_US

lishixinzhi/Article/program/Oracle/201311/18577


網(wǎng)站欄目:oracle腳本怎么設(shè)置 oracle腳本編寫(xiě)
當(dāng)前鏈接:http://weahome.cn/article/hpposd.html

其他資訊

在線咨詢

微信咨詢

電話咨詢

028-86922220(工作日)

18980820575(7×24)

提交需求

返回頂部